But there's a silver lining, according to online jobs board ... WebWhat Are Entry-Level Jobs? Usually, an entry-level job is a position that sits on the bottom rung of a career ladder. It’s the first role on a path, allowing professionals to begin a journey into their target field. In most cases, the best entry-level jobs focus on skill growth and development.
